AIDS: the contamination risk in urological surgery

Summary
Surgeons face a 32% risk of exposure to Human Immunodeficiency Virus (HIV) during urological surgery. Endoscopic procedures pose a higher risk to the face and eyes, necessitating technique and equipment modifications for safety.

Background:
- Increasing prevalence of Human Immunodeficiency Virus (HIV) in surgical patients.
- Unknown risk of viral exposure during urological procedures.
Purpose of the Study:
- Quantify the risk of surgeon exposure to HIV during urological surgery.
- Identify specific procedures with higher contamination risks.
- Inform necessary changes in surgical practices and equipment.
Main Methods:
- Prospective assessment of 427 consecutive urological operations.
- Monitoring for contamination of surgeon's skin, face, and mucous membranes.
- Categorization of contamination by surgical approach (open vs. endoscopic).
Main Results:
- Overall contamination rate of 32% (136 of 427 procedures).
- Endoscopic procedures showed a 33% contamination rate (99 of 304).
- Face and eye contamination occurred in 46% of endoscopic cases.
Conclusions:
- Significant risk of exposure to infectious body fluids exists in urological surgery.
- Endoscopic urological procedures require specific attention for facial and eye protection.
- Modifications in surgical techniques and equipment are crucial to minimize surgeon exposure.
